This is rye grain (Secale cereale)- not Ryegrass(Lolium). It is not for over-seeding lawns.Open-pollinated. Annual. Heirloom. Non-GMO Organic winter rye cover crop is one of the most diverse and efficient performers in any garden. Heirlo...
